Ruby勉強会第7回

今回も、初心者対応でお題は後回しに。(><

 

今回のお題は.....パズルみたい!(°∀°)

 

【テロリストと人質の川越え】

テロリストが3名、人質を3名連れています。

逃げる途中、河に出くわしました。

渡し船がありますが......

 

・船には2人しか乗れません

・川を渡ったら、船を戻すために一人で漕ぎ返さなければなりません

・船には人質だけ、もしくはテロリストだけ乗ることもできます

・どちらの岸辺も、人質よりテロリストが多くなってはいけません

 (面倒くさくなって殺してしまうらしい)

 

画面への表示と、無事に渡れるかのチェックをどう作るかが

ポイントのようです。

正解が出るまでプログラムに総当たりで自動チェックさせるか、

人間が入力してミニゲームみたいに作るかでも、コードがだいぶ

人によって変わってくるお題ですね。

 

 

*おまけ*

先週だいぶ悩んだ、Sublime Text で全角スペースを表示させる方法が

こちらのページにありました。多謝。

 

【Sublime Text 2 初心者向け インストール・設定方法】